U.K. PM May Delivers A Speech On The State Of Politics

Theresa May, U.K. prime minster, delivers a speech on the state of politics at Chatham House in London, U.K., on Wednesday, July 17, 2019. May, in what is expected to be her final set-piece speech as prime minister, warned against the "absolutism and failure to compromise that meant her Brexit deal was unable to win the support of Parliament.
